About the Conference

Addressing global climate change, promoting energy transition and green development, fostering sustainable use of natural resources, and achieving harmony between humanity and nature have become an international consensus. The high-quality development of green and low-carbon cities is a necessary response to the people's aspirations for a better life.

The 2026 International Conference on Natural Resources and Planning will be held at The University of Hong Kong in March 2026, coinciding with the 75th anniversary of the Faculty of Architecture and the 45th anniversary of the Department of Urban Planning and Design at HKU.

This conference aims to provide an interactive platform for experts and scholars from a wide range of disciplines, including natural resource management, urban transformation and development, and architectural and cultural heritage conservation, to contribute to a shared future for humanity and strive for a harmonious and sustainable relationship between society and nature.
